docker系列(一)
docker快速入门
一、前提
- 拥有一个Linux系统(建议使用CentOS7)
二、安装docker步骤
- 清除系统中可能有docker
sudo yum remove docker \
docker-client \
docker-client-latest \
docker-common \
docker-latest \
docker-latest-logrotate \
docker-logrotate \
docker-engine
- 安装docker需要的环境
sudo yum install -y yum-utils
sudo yum-config-manager \
--add-repo \
https://download.docker.com/linux/centos/docker-ce.repo
- 安装docker引擎
sudo yum install docker-ce docker-ce-cli containerd.io
此处可以根据自己的需求,刚开始学习使用docker可以只需要docker-ce就能满足使用的需求
三、入门使用
- 启动docker
sudo systemctl start docker
- 让我们跑起第一个容器
sudo docker run hello-world
成功安装运行将会输出hello world!。
- 关于docker镜像加速
由于docker官方的网站是外网(所以你懂得!),因此建议使用国内镜像加速,例如阿里镜像加速(如果没有自己的阿里云账户快自己注册一个吧)。
在阿里云的产品中的容器与中间件选择右侧的容器镜像服务ACR,然后进入控制台。根据自己的操作系统选择,并按照流程完成就OK!